Job summary
This is an excellent opportunity to join the Homerton School Nursing Service to progress and develop your leadership skills while strengthening your public health knowledge and skills in this specialist area all within a highly successful Trust. This post is only for candidates who are qualified school nurses who has undertaken training to be a Specialist Community Public Health Nurse: School Nurse

We are seeking Band 6 Specialist Community Public Health School Nurses, highly motivated, enthusiastic, innovative, and forward-thinking with a strong public health focus.

You must be fully committed to improving the health and wellbeing of our diverse population which is in the heart of London Borough of Hackney and the City of London. If you want to be part of our dynamic school nursing team, then this post is for you.

The post is school, and community based, at various sites as required by the needs of the service. We cover primary, secondary, special schools and Pupil Referral Unit (PRU), across a wide area with diverse needs to deliver the healthy child programme 5-19 (25 SEND).

You must have SCPHN - School Nursing qualification and with current NMC registration.

Main duties of the job
  • Delivering the Healthy Child Programme across the allocated schools, prioritising the specific health needs of individual children and young people where required
  • Ensure all service delivery and practice undertaken with children and young people takes account of their disability, diversity and religious customs.
  • Use evidence-based programmes to improve outcomes for children and young people in school and those who are home schooled.
  • Plan, develop, implement and evaluate health improvement programmes that take place within the school setting or the community
  • Initiative outreach clinics to enable parents and carers to access additional support and advice for their children
  • Contribute to developing and or reviewing Standard Operating Procedures that facilitate good practice, and implementing these in all relevant aspects of practice and service provision
  • Contribute and respond to public health guidance and health promotion needs as well as new ways of meeting population health needs
  • Encourage service users to engage in health promotion and public health messages and enable them to provide appropriate lived experience to support the programmes
  • Contribute and engage in effective ways of service delivery including the development and use of pathways that enable seamless service provision for service users

Disclosure and Barring Service Check
This post is subject to the Rehabilitation of Offenders Act (Exceptions Order) 1975 and as such it will be necessary for a submission for Disclosure to be made to the Disclosure and Barring Service (formerly known as CRB) to check for any previous criminal convictions.

Certificate of Sponsorship
Applications from job seekers who require current Skilled worker sponsorship to work in the UK are welcome and will be considered alongside all other applications. For further information visit the UK Visas and Immigration website.

From 6 April 2017, skilled worker applicants, applying for entry clearance into the UK, have had to present a criminal record certificate from each country they have resided continuously or cumulatively for 12 months or more in the past 10 years. Adult dependants (over 18 years old) are also subject to this requirement. Guidance can be found here Criminal records checks for overseas applicants.
